Abstract: | The book by Agata Zawiszewska, a researcher from Szczecin, fully devoted to the
columnist-writing of Irena Krzywicka, a well-known inter-war writer and activist, is
a perfect compendium of knowledge about the changes of traditions of the Second
Republic of Poland. The author of a thick book concentrates above all on a discontinued
Polish feminist thought, and places Krzywicka’s works on a map of female writing. Życie
świadome. O nowoczesnej prozie intelektualnej Ireny Krzywickiej is a large-scale project
worthy of a feminist conception of ginocriticism, the nature of which is above all the
woman, her works, action and life conscious of the inter-war period. |
